- The distance between Smithers, Bc, Canada and Tegucigalpa, Honduras is approximately 5,692 km or 3,537 mi.
- To reach Smithers, Bc in this distance one would set out from Tegucigalpa bearing 331.6°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Smithers, Bc bearing 306.9° or NW .
- Smithers, Bc has a boreal subarctic climate with dry summers (Dsc) whereas Tegucigalpa has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- Smithers, Bc is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Tegucigalpa is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 17.9 °C (32.1°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 19.8 °C (35.6°F) more in Smithers, Bc.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 362.3 mm (14.3 in) less which is equivalent to 362.3 l/m² (8.89 US gal/ft²) or 3,623,000 l/ha (387,323 US gal/ac) less. About 3/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 37° lower in Smithers, Bc than in Tegucigalpa.
